Use of SWIFT Code Teamsters Phoenix Hartford-Ct City in United States (US)
Teamsters Phoenix SWIFT Codes are used when transferring money between banks, particularly for international wire transfers, and also for the exchange of other messages between banks. The codes can sometimes be found on account statements. To do Overseas funds transfer the SWIFT Code Teamsters Phoenix is required.
